TWISTED SISTER: Jay Jay's Not Gonna Take It

Twisted Sister guitarist Jay Jay French has his knickers in a twist over The Rolling Stones, Judas Priest and Led Zeppelin. He recently lashed out at all three bands during a Q&A session at the Spooky Empire convention in Orlando, Florida.

Rolling Stones: "Watching Keith [Richards] and [Ronnie Wood] trying to play guitar is like being driven in a tour bus by José Feliciano and Ray Charles without GPS -- it's a terrifying experience. If the Stones were smart, they'd hire two 25-year-old guys from Nashville who know how to play their song parts and let these two cadavers walk around on stage and act like Johnny Depp in Pirates of the Caribbean. They can't play. And it bothers me they charge $800 [for a ticket]. At least when you go to see the Eaglesthere's 45 guys on stage, 'cause you want the [band] to sound like the Eagles. And when you see go see Roger Waters, there's 45 guys on stage, 'cause you wanna hear what The Wall sounds like. But the Stones insist that you watch them decompose in front of your eyes for a high ticket price. And they suck so bad."

Judas Priest: "K.K.'s [Downing, guitar] gone -- he went to golf. And now Glenn's [Tipton, guitar] left. And it's wonderful. And now it's a cover band, essentially... Foreigner is a complete cover band. There's nobody left in Foreigner."

Led Zeppelin: "[They] were deteriorating so badly that by 1975, you couldn't go to a Zep concert without throwing up. They were so bad! You couldn't give tickets away to Zep concerts, but if you came to see Zebra playing Zeppelin on Long Island, you heard perfect Zeppelin."

By the way, Jay Jay is a fan of the Stones, Priest and Zeppelin.
